Description For DFT Verification Engineer

NVIDIA is seeking a DFT Verification Engineer to join their team in developing next-generation DFT technologies. This role offers a unique opportunity to work on advanced technologies and complex products in the Switches, NIC, and SoC product lines. The position involves working closely with various aspects of chip design, backend, verification, and production testing.

As a DFT Verification Engineer, you'll be responsible for verifying the design and implementation of DFT technologies across various projects. You'll work with sophisticated verification methodologies and be part of a team that develops unique and innovative DFT solutions. The role requires collaboration with multiple teams, including architects, designers, and silicon verification specialists.

The ideal candidate should have a strong foundation in electrical or computer engineering, with expertise in RTL design using Verilog. Experience with verification tools and environments is highly valued, particularly with SV/Specman and Python. Responsibilities For DFT Verification Engineer

  • Verification of DFT design, architecture and micro-architecture using sophisticated verification methodologies
  • Understand design & implementation, define verification scope
  • Develop verification infrastructure (Testbenches, BFMs, Checkers, Monitors)
  • Execute test/coverage plans and verify design correctness
  • Collaborate with architects, designers, emulation, production testing and silicon verification teams
